WEBVTT 00:00:00.179 --> 00:00:05.119 Targ‘ib etilmagan mashg‘ulot | Hayotiy aloritmlar: Qog‘oz Samolyot 00:00:07.179 --> 00:00:10.059 Bu dars hayotiy algoritmlar deb nomlanadi. 00:00:10.070 --> 00:00:15.140 Algoritmlar odamlar har kuni qiladigan narsalarni ifodalaydi. Shirinliklar retseptlari va qushxona qurish uchun yo‘nalishlar 00:00:15.140 --> 00:00:20.369 ikkalasi ham har kungi algoritmlardir. Bugun biz qog‘oz samolyot uchun bitta algortimni 00:00:20.369 --> 00:00:27.279 tuzib, yaratib va sinab ko‘rmoqchimiz. Ammo, birinchi biz bu katta loyihani bajarishga oson bo‘lgan 00:00:27.279 --> 00:00:32.590 kichik bosqichlarga bo‘lib chiqmoqchimiz. Biron qog‘oz samolyot yasash uchun, qanaqa 00:00:32.590 --> 00:00:37.390 bosqichlar bo‘lishini va ularni qanaqa tartibda tuzish kerakligini hal qilib olishimiz kerak. Siz algoritmingizni birinchi 00:00:37.390 --> 00:00:42.880 rasmlarni alohida kesib olishdan boshlaysiz. Keyin, siz qog‘oz samolyot yasash uchun kerak bo‘ladigan 00:00:42.880 --> 00:00:47.730 bosqichlar tasvirlangan 6 ta rasmni tanlaysiz va bu rasmlarni to‘g‘ri tartibda joylashtirib chiqasiz. Barchasi 00:00:47.730 --> 00:00:52.140 tartiblangandan so‘ng, algoritm ishlayotgan ishlamayotganini sinab ko‘rish uchun algoritmlaringizni jamoadagi 00:00:52.140 --> 00:00:57.020 boshqa talabalar bilan almashtirib ko‘rasiz. Yaxshi dizanlashtirilgan algoritm eng yaxshi 00:00:57.020 --> 00:01:01.320 samolyotlarni yasashda katta ahamiyatga ega. 00:01:06.740 --> 00:01:10.000 Agar biz shokalad tayyorlashni xohlasak, bu jarayon uchun 00:01:10.000 --> 00:01:15.240 ko‘plab katta bosqichlar mavjud. Va bu har bir katta bosqich o‘zining kichikroq bosqichlari to‘plamidan tashkil topgan. 00:01:15.240 --> 00:01:19.290 Va biz shokaladni ta’mi qanday bo‘lishini xohlashimizga qarab turli xil retseptlar, yoki algoritmlar mavjud. 00:01:19.290 --> 00:01:23.990 Har bir bosqich, hattoki kichkinaginalari ham muhim ahamiyatga ega. Demak, biron bosqichsiz, qolganlarini 00:01:23.990 --> 00:01:30.729 amalga oshirib bo‘lmaydi. Boshqalar ham tushuna oladigan algortim yaratish juda muhim. 00:01:30.729 --> 00:01:34.630 Shuning uchun har bir bosqich yozib borilishi kerak, shunda, uni kim qilishidan qat’i nazar natija bir xil bo‘laveradi.